    We have no way of knowing exactly what you have tried that doesn't work unless you tell us. A flashing question mark boot means that your Mac is unable to locate a startup disk to boot from.

    If you haven't tried... start your Mac holding the key Option. That should launch the boot window manager have been, you can select the startup disk, and then click on restart.

    If this does not help, you will need to take the Mac for the service.

    If a flashing question mark appears when you start your Mac - Apple Support

  • Flow of HT 7-5709 - Boot/startup problems

    I just bought the HP Jet 7 tablet.  The first time I turned on the Tablet, I saw the HP logo for a few seconds and the device off.  The dots has not yet come full circle.  I thought it might be a power problem, so I plugged it and saw the charging symbol on the screen.  I waited for a while and tried again.  I had to hold the power button on 5 + seconds until I could see the backlight lights up so I know it wasn't sleep.

    This time, he said "Automatic repair of preparation."  Points of fact just two revolutions and the device suddenly stops.  Next time, he had no any text and points to the subject a spin before stopping.

    I let it charge overnight.  I tried from the start this morning and it alternates between the two start modes.  Points are about a year and a half laps if there is no text and about two if it says "Automatic repair of preparation."

    I'm able to get in the boot without difficulty menu.  The diagnostic system is no problem.  The only thing that stands out on the screen "System information", it is that the "born on Date" is "00/00/0000." The date of the main battery is "27/10/2014."

    I went to the website listed on the start menu (hp.com/go/techcenter/startup), but don't see anything relevant.

    If I select F11 (System Restore) in the start menu, it returns me to a screen with an HP logo and the text "Please wait".  Points do two or three laps and the powers of the device down.

    Suggestions?

    Yes, I had this problem and a few others here did too.  The solution is to run the battery completely down and it will say 'reset CMOS' when you put it to the top.  It should then be started normally.  You can expedite the discharge of the battery by running UEFI Boot Menu F2 System Diagnostics = > System Tests = > large trial = > loop up to the error.  If you have an OTG adpater, you can also plug a USB hub without power or whatever USB devices you have and who's going to pull it down faster.

    Another option is to disconnect the battery, HP Jet 7 Tablet Maintenance and Service Guide says this can be done by simply removing the back cover, but this seems incorrect.  I watched my 7 steam and the cable of the battery falls below the intermediate mount cover so this must also be removed to expose the system board and the battery connector, it is held by six screws.  I opted to run the battery instead.

    Once the shelf upward, toward the latest EFI firmware update should hopefully prevent him of happening again.
